HC Deb 19 June 1975 vol 893 cc527-8W
Mr. Wm. Ross

asked the Secretary of State for Northern Ireland if he will now, in view of the assurances given by his officials recently to a member of the Northern Ireland Convention, state the earliest and latest dates by which Loyalist prisoners serving their sentences in Great Britain will be returned to a prison in Northern Ireland.

Mr. Merlyn Rees

The transfer of prisoners from Great Britain to Northern Ireland depends upon security, compassionate and other considerations. It is not practicable to announce the date of the transfer of any particular prisoner in advance.
